Profile
Personal
- Resided in San Diego, California in 1954.
- Self-identified as being of Scottish-Irish-German ancestry.
- Shows his hobbies are guns, hunting and golf.
Pre-professional career
- Graduated from San Diego High School.
- Attended San Diego State.
- Played baseball and basketball at San Diego State.
Outside of baseball
- Is a draftsman during the off-season.
- Served in the U. S. Army Air Corps for three years.
